Tomio Koyama Gallery Kyobashi is pleased to present “good day,” a solo exhibition by German sculptor Stephan Balkenhol.

This will be the artist’s fourth solo exhibition at Tomio Koyama Gallery and his first in six years, and will feature new works by the artist. People and animals that look like they could be from anywhere, but with something distinctive about their facial expression and demeanor. Stephan Balkenhol (1957-) has won international acclaim for his minimalist representations of figurative motifs in the form of standing figures and reliefs.

Carved from the wood of a single tree along with the pedestal they stand on, the elaborate, rough surfaces of these works that retain strong traces of his chisel and their coloring leave a lasting impression. Balkenhol’s works have a rich appeal that elicits the humor and introspection of the viewer, as well as a presence that while not difficult, is somehow intriguing.
